问题是运行malloc 1001次,大小为4,将每个返回的指针存储为char *,然后得到第一个指针和最后一个指针之间的差异,以计算所使用的总内存。指令还指出,这个数字将远远高于人们的预期。到目前为止,这就是我所拥有的,但我不认为它能正常工作(即使是这样,如果有人能告诉我如何更有效地做到这一点,我也会很感激):#include <stdlib.h>{ }
// Get first and la
我还希望程序检查用户是否将宽度或高度设置为正数或负值。如果用户输入一个负值,我希望它显示一个错误。到目前为止,这就是我所拥有的,但它只是略过一步,还算过了。Rectangle Area & Perimeter Calculator")
width = io.read("n")
if width <0enter a positive value for width